  11. No, nothing like it. 32 gtst calipers are 4 pot and 12mm bolts. S2 stag calipers are 2 pot (huge) and 14mm bolts.

  20. I was looking into mix matching housings, staring with my 2530 ... I'm thinking of upgrading the compressor side of my HKS GT2530 turbo. The turbine side of the 2530 atm is a 76 trim (53.8 major - 47.0 exducer) wheel and 0.64AR T3 housing which I was going to keep. Thinking of throwing on, on the compressor side ... Garrett T04S upgrade kit wheel: 59 / 76 / 60 trim housing: AR70 (rated to 550hp) Now the 2530 is internally gated. I'm looking for a responsive daily driven turbo for 250+awkw, with enough poke for track days and time attacks. There is another T04S compressor kit, which may be too big for the 76 trim turbine ... Garrett T04S upgrade kit wheel: 61.4 / 82 / 56 trim housing: AR70 (rated to 600hp). Thoughts?

  24. I've got R33 GTST rear calipers on my S2 Stagea. They fitted up easy with the R33 GTST rear rotors too (16mm stock to 18mm). Just make sure you get the rubber brake lines with them to hook up to your hard lines.
